17 Of Londoners Have Had Covid 19 Health Secretary Says

Hancock outlined the figure during the Downing Street press briefing. The health secretary said that the results of the Government’s antibody surveillance study have shown 17 percent of people in London and five percent of the population in the rest of the country have tested positive for COVID-19 antibodies. Given London’s population, that would mean 1.5 million people in the capital have had the virus.
